Colour, skin tests and your health
This section matters more than the rest of this page.
Please read it.
A skin test is required at least 48 hours before any colour
service if you’re new to us, or if it’s been three
months or more since your last test with us.
The skin test is free and takes a couple of minutes.
We can’t carry out a colour service without a valid skin test on
file. This isn’t flexible — it’s how allergic reactions are
caught before they happen, and our insurance depends on it.
Please tell us about any medical conditions, allergies, sensitivities,
medication or pregnancy before your appointment, and tell us if anything has
changed since your last visit.
Please tell us honestly about your hair history — especially any
colour, bleach, henna or box dye you’ve used, including at home. Some
products react badly with salon colour, and we can only judge that if we
know.
We may ask you to fill in a short consultation form before certain
services.
We may decline or stop a service if we believe it would damage your hair
or your health. We’ll always explain why and talk through the
alternatives.
